A 40-year-old resident of Picher, Forrest R. Evans, died Tuesday afternoon in an ambulance while en route from his home to the office of a Miami physician. A former miner and barber, Evans had been in poor health for several months. Surviving are his wife, Juanita Evans, and seven children, ranging in age from six months to 13 years, all of the home at 601 South Ella street, Picher. The children are Richard Evans, Forrest Jr. Evans, William Evans, Stanley Evans, Anna Marie Evans, Betty Jean Evans, Linda Sue Evans and Patricia Jo Evans. Also surviving are Evans' mother, Mrs. Adeline Collins, Picher; three brothers, Harry Evans and Mearl Evans, both of Pontiac, and Rolla Evans, Waynesville Missouri; four sisters, Mrs. Mary Hopper, Quapaw Oklahoma; Mrs. Jewell Simmons, Waynesville; Mrs. Ruby Burt, Wichita Kansas, and Mrs. Golda Vanderpool, Pontiac Michigan. Funeral arrangements will be under direction of the Mitchelson mortuary, Commerce.
